【问题标题】:Unable to load the gem无法加载宝石
【发布时间】:2014-05-05 09:47:43
【问题描述】:

我创建了一个名为“my_gem”的 gem。我在我的 Gemfile 中使用它就像

gem 'my_gem' path: "/home/user/project" #git: "git@bitbucket.org:Teamlaunch/launch-service-app.git", branch: "master"

我能够构建宝石。我也可以使用“bundle install”命令安装这个 gem。但是当我通过 rails 控制台运行它时,它无法识别 gem

 $rails c
 2.1.0 :007 >   require 'my_gem'
 LoadError: cannot load such file -- my_gem

【问题讨论】:

  • 您的宝石结构是什么?您确定您的 gem 库被命名为 gem 本身吗?
  • @MarekLipka - 你能在答案部分添加这个吗?更正宝石名称后它的工作
  • 完成了。已添加答案。

标签: ruby-on-rails ruby ruby-on-rails-4 gem bundler


【解决方案1】:

您的库的名称可能与 gem 不同。因此,请检查您的库是如何命名的,并分别更改 require 的参数。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2019-02-19
    相关资源
    最近更新 更多